Proposal
(see application form for more details) Tree1 - English Oak: Reduce material on one side, remove identified lower branch back to stem with appropriate pruning cut (see photo), reduce branches in mid section of canopy by no more than 1.5m and minimal crown thinning up to 75mm, remove Deadwood throughout canopy. Tree 2 - English Oak: Crown lift up to 5m, crown reduction by up to 2m. Tree 3 - Leyland cypress: Fell to ground level. Tree 4 - Ash: Remove snapped limb and tidy up failure stub with appropriate pruning cut.

About tree works applications
Applications for works to trees cover protected trees: consent under a tree preservation order, or six weeks notice for trees in a conservation area. More in our guide to planning application types.
